**Ticket: Config drift on WavePeek preview service**

Waveform preview renderers in prod no longer match the reviewed baseline. Someone hand-edited sample-rate limits and upload size caps on two nodes; the third still runs the approved set. Security concern: the drifted caps exceed what the Brambleton assessment signed off on. Need a decision on which set wins before we re-converge. Current values pulled from the drifted nodes are below.

deployment values, kajep-kageg:
[praix]
host = praix.paliqcorp.corp
user = praix_svc
database = praix_prod

**Configuration**

Memtrace profiles GPU allocations per kernel launch. Set `MEMTRACE_DEVICE` to the target device index and `MEMTRACE_SAMPLE_HZ` (default 50). Reviewers: reject configs sampling above 200 Hz on shared nodes. Traces upload to the Glasswork collector, which requires authentication. The collector credential goes in `.env` at the repo root as a single line:

sealed setting: RELAY_SECRET13=bca49b02a6971

Handover: Fareglass rules engine (shipping fees) was stable all week. One open item — plugin authors keep hitting the new schema validation on custom surcharge rules; v3 plugins need the fee-type field or they're rejected at load. Docs updated, migration guide published. No config rollbacks pending. External authors with rejected plugins should not file platform tickets; route them to the plugin support queue instead.

escalation mailbox, bafog-fafog: ulador@paliqlabs.internal